What really happened

In the auction ad it states to specify the weight, etc, when you pay for it. In the page when the order is being processed by paypal there is an area for "instructions to the seller" and I put those instructions in there specifically and have a copy of that transaction on my paypal account which is proof I can furnish if anyone doesn't believe me. I was very very clear on how I wanted the cue delivered. I had a friend who is like 63 yrs old, and has played pool for over 40 years, and has played with just about everything, and he didn't think the cue was any good either. The tip is like a piece of glass, it makes a ton of noise, it vibrates out of your hand with a loose grip, and with the weight of like 17.5 oz the balance is way out of whack. I am going to change the weight myself, the tip, and have a wrap put on it to see if it makes a difference. If not, it'll just be a house cue. It might sound dumb to put anymore money into the cue, but sometimes a few small changes do make a difference. The cuemaker should have shot with the thing before he shipped it, and he would've known if he is any kind of pool player that it hits strange and really throws the ball. It almost creates a jump shot masse effect when the cueball is near the rail. I've never miscued so many times, or had to use a tip tool so many times. The ferrule doesn't even fit the diameter of the shaft, and the ink from one of the rings looks like it kinda bled off the edges of the ring when the finish was put on. It looks like paint.
